Otc - Active Ingredient Section


Active Ingredient

Ethyl Alcohol 62%

Otc - Purpose Section


Purpose

Antimicrobial

Indications & Usage Section


Uses

Hand sanitizer to help reduce bacteria on the skin that could cause disease

Recommended for repeated use

Warnings Section


Warnings

Flammable. Keep away from fire or flame.

For external use only.

OTC - WHEN USING SECTION


When using this product do not use in or near eyes.

If in eyes, flush thoroughly with water.

ADVERSE REACTIONS SECTION


If irritation or rash appears and persists, stop use and see a physician.

OTC - KEEP OUT OF REACH OF CHILDREN SECTION


Keep out of reach of children. If swallowed, call a physician or Poison Control Center immediately.

Dosage & Administration Section


Directions

Dispense an adequate amount of hand sanitizer

Rub hands together until completely dry

Safe Handling Warning Section


Other information

Do not store above 110 F (43 C)

May discolor some fabrics or surfaces

Inactive Ingredient Section


Inactive ingredients

Water (Aqua), PEG-10 Dimethicone, PEG-12 Dimethicone, PEG-8 Dimethicone, Glycerin, Propylene Glycol, Isopropyl Myristate, Aloe, and Tocopheryl Acetate.
